DNS cache issue

Expected Behaviour:

Enabling/Disabling pihole, changing settings, rebooting the system, Black/Whitelisting,
and updating gravity lists all will clear the cached DNS entries.

Actual Behaviour:

DNS cache is being cleared!

Debug Token:

https://tricorder.pi-hole.net/cfahm1i63l

What is leading you to believe that the Pi-hole FTL cache is not being cleared?

I do not have technical knowledge about Pi-hole FTL, so I do not know if it's normal behavior to clear the cache every time I disable/enable the pihole... for me it sounds weird that the cache is cleared for any changes are made on the system... in this way, it is almost useless idea of DNS caching since it will reset on every gravity update..

From your post it's not clear what behavior you expect and what you are seeing. Please clarify.

Is it normal that the DNS cache are zeroed when i enable/disable the pihole? Or when update the gravity lists?

Yes it's normal.

Gravity triggers

Enable triggers

Which means:


They question is: Does it really need to a reload,which flushes the cache, or would a reload-lists be sufficient?

1 Like

Thank you, you have concluded what I wanted to say!

@Developers

Do we really need a reload instead of reload-lists after each gravity run and after dis/enabling pihole?

This topic was automatically closed 21 days after the last reply. New replies are no longer allowed.